Christina Kaas Elmgreen

  • Position Fly
  • Height 0-0
  • Class Senior
  • Hometown Charlottenlund, Denmark

Biography

As A Senior (2018-19)
CSCAA Honorable Mention Scholar All-American… CCSA Swimmer of the Week twice during the season… three-time finalist at the 2019 CCSA Championships, 200 fly (second, 1:58.99), 100 fly (third, 54.06), third, 200 yard individual medley (2:01.86)… Became the first swimmer in FGCU history to have medaled in every single race she has competed at the CCSA Championships.

As A Junior (2017-18)
CSCAA Scholar All-American First Team Honors … Three-time individual finalist at the CCSA Championships; placing second in both the 200 fly (1:57.18) and the 200 IM (2:01.71), captured 1st-place in the 100 fly in a personal best and NCAA ‘B’ standard time of 53.27, placing her third in the FGCU record book… Time-trialed the 200 fly at the start of CCSA’s to clock a new personal best and NCAA ‘B’ standard time of 1:55.55 giving her a new school and conference record… Competed at the NCAA Swimming Championships in the 100 and 200 fly… Recorded 17 top-3 finishes throughout the season.

As A Sophomore (2016-17)
Became the fourth consecutive Eagle to take home CCSA Women’s Swimmer of the Year honors … was also named the Most Outstanding Female Swimmer of the CCSA Championships and earned CCSA All-Conference recognition after winning the conference crown in the 100 fly (53.53 seconds) and 200 IM (1:59.65) … her time in both events were personal records and the fastest on the team during the season … they also ranked 4th and 3rd, respectively, in FGCU program history … tabbed CSCAA First Team Scholar All-American with 3.5 GPA or higher and NCAA Championship appearance ... placed 2nd in the 200 fly with a time of 1:57.10 at the CCSA Championship meet … recorded a time of 1:56.24 at the CCSA Championship time trial and broke the FGCU and CCSA record while also qualifying for the NCAA Championship meet … set the FGCU record on three occasions during the season … competed in the 100 fly, 200 fly and 200 IM and the NCAA Championships … was also a member of the conference champion 400 medley relay (3:38.16) … turned in a total of 14 NCAA ‘B’ cuts … was named the CCSA Swimmer of the Week on three occasions throughout the season.

As A Freshman (2015-16)
Earned CCSA All-Conference recognition as the conference champion in the 200 fly (1:57.63) to go along with a runner-up finish in the 400 IM (4:16.73) and 3rd-place finish in the 200 IM (2:00.65) … set the FGCU record in the 200 fly with a time of 1:57.56 at the Last Chance Meet … also clocked NCAA ‘B’ cut times in the 100 fly, 200 fly, 200 IM and 400 IM but finished just outside of the NCAA Championship cut line … recorded six of the program’s top-eight times in the 200 fly this season … tallied four individual wins on the season, all coming in the 200 fly … also holds the second-best time in FGCU history in the 400 IM … received CCSA All-Academic honors.

High School
Won the 100m IM at the Eastern Championships in 2014 in a time of 1:04.26 … finished third in the 100m IM with a time of 1:02.94 during the 2014 Danish Short Course Championships … turned in personal-best 200-meter butterfly times of 2:12.98 (short course) and 2:15.38 (long course) at nationals ... won a Danish National Championship ... attended Ordrup Gymnasium.
